Type
Purpose:
Displays
the
contents
of
a
text
file
on
the
screen.
Syntax:
type
[drive:lfilename
Comments:
To
view
a
text
file
without
modifying it, you can use
the
type
command. (Use
dir
to
find
the
name
of
a file, and
edlin
to
change
the
contents
of
a file.)
Note that
when
you use
type
to
display a file that contains tabs,
all
the
tabs are expanded
to
8 spaces wide. Also,
if
you
try
to
display a binary file, you may
see
strange characters
on
the
screen,
including bells, formfeeds, and escape sequences.
Example:
If you
want
to display
the
contents
of
a file called holiday. mar,
you
would
type the following command:
type
holiday.mar
